Solarius PV Review: A Professional Standard for Solar Design

Solarius PV, developed by ACCA software, is a comprehensive BIM-integrated tool designed for professionals to model, simulate, and analyze photovoltaic systems. Key Features

BIM Integration: It allows for a complete 3D BIM model of the PV system, integrating architectural and technical data.

Automated Documentation: The software automatically generates technical reports, economic feasibility studies, and project drawings.

Shading Analysis: Includes advanced tools for assessing site shading to ensure maximum energy production.

Financial Reports: Provides detailed financial analysis, including payback periods and ROI, which are critical for commercial EPCs. Pros and Cons Pros:

User-Friendly: Known for an intuitive interface and a relatively short learning curve compared to some competitors.

Comprehensive: Covers everything from initial site assessment to final economic analysis in one platform. Cons:

Platform Limits: Primarily built for Windows-only desktop architecture.

Market Focus: Strongly optimized for European engineering workflows and IEC standards, which may limit its use for certain US-based projects. How to Access Safely

Solarius PV is a professional software solution for the design, simulation, and documentation of grid-connected photovoltaic (PV) systems. While users may search for "cracks" or unauthorized versions, utilizing official, updated software ensures data accuracy, access to technical support, and protection against security risks inherent in pirated files. Key Features of Solarius PV

The software provides a comprehensive suite of tools for solar professionals:

Step-by-Step Assisted Design: An intuitive editor that guides users through the entire sizing and assessment process, from site evaluation to final documentation. Advanced Shading Analysis: When it comes to using software like Solarius

Evaluates shading from distant obstacles (e.g., mountains or buildings) using photographic surveys.

Calculates shading from nearby objects like chimneys or antennas over annual, monthly, or hourly periods.

Automatically determines the minimum spacing required between parallel module rows. System Layout & Electrical Sizing: Supports both roof-mounted and ground-mounted arrays.

Automates string configuration, inverter selection, and cable sizing with integrated DC/AC check functions. Financial & Technical Reporting:

Generates detailed financial analyses, bills of materials (BOM), and single-line electrical diagrams.

Estimates energy yield and performance ratios to support feasibility studies for residential, commercial, or utility-scale projects.

BIM Integration: Features tools that allow for BIM-compliant workflows, enhancing interoperability with other engineering and construction platforms. Access & Support

Solarius PV, developed by ACCA software, is a comprehensive BIM-based tool designed for the technical and financial analysis of photovoltaic systems. An interesting and standout feature is its shading analysis from photographic surveys, which allows users to calculate shading coefficients directly from simple site photos. Core Technical Features

BIM & 3D Modeling: The software features a 3D/BIM modeler that allows designers to define building footprints and obstacles using parametric objects. It supports importing various formats including AutoCAD DXF/DWG and IFC models from other BIM software.

Automated Design Tools: It automatically recognizes orientation and tilt data for selected surfaces and filters out obstacles like chimneys or dormers to optimize panel positioning.

Electrical Verification: The software automatically generates single-line wiring diagrams for the system, including switchboards, cables, and protective devices.

Global Climate Data: Integration with databases like Meteonorm and PVGIS provides accurate solar irradiation data for locations worldwide. Economic and Reporting Capabilities

Financial Analysis: Users can generate detailed business plans that include key indicators such as Net Present Value (NPV), Internal Rate of Return (IRR), and payback time.

Photo-simulation: This tool enables high-quality photorealistic rendering of the designed system overlaid on site photos to show clients the visual impact of the installation.

Multi-language Support: Professional technical and financial reports can be generated in five languages: English, Spanish, French, Portuguese, and Catalan.

Searching for "best" cracks for Solarius PV (or any professional engineering software) exposes you and your business to severe security, legal, and operational risks. Using unauthorized software for professional solar design can compromise project safety and lead to catastrophic technical failures. Risks of Using Cracked Software

Security Threats: Cracked files are prime targets for hackers to hide malicious code. These can act as spies, tracking keystrokes, stealing sensitive client data, or opening "backdoors" for remote access.

Legal Consequences: Software piracy is illegal and can lead to heavy fines, legal fees, and civil lawsuits. For professionals, being caught using pirated tools can permanently damage your reputation and client trust.

System Instability: Cracked versions are often unstable because original code has been tampered with. They lack critical updates and patches, making them prone to crashing and losing hours of complex design work.

Safety & Compliance: Professional solar software like Solarius PV includes built-in diagnostics to prevent design errors. Using a modified version risks incorrect calculations (such as wind loads or electrical sizing), which can lead to fires or structural collapses. Safe and Legitimate Alternatives
